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or upgrading windows that serve as emergency exits in residential or commercial properties. These windows are designed to be easily accessible and operable in case of emergencies, such as fires or other urgent situations. The installation process typically includes assessing the existing window opening, selecting appropriate escape window models, and ensuring proper fitting and functionality. Skilled contractors focus on creating a secure, compliant, and functional escape route that enhances safety without compromising the property's aesthetic or structural integrity.

This service addresses several common problems faced by property owners. For instance, older windows may not meet current safety standards or may be difficult to open quickly during emergencies. Additionally, poorly functioning or damaged windows can hinder safe evacuation and may pose security concerns. Installing dedicated escape windows helps ensure that occupants have a reliable means of egress, potentially reducing hazards during emergencies. Proper installation also helps prevent issues such as leaks, drafts, or structural damage that can arise from improper window fitting.

The overview below groups typical Escape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bath, ME.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ost for materials used in escape window installation typically ranges from $200 to $800, depending on window size and type. For example, a standard basement escape window may cost around $300 in materials. Custom or larger windows can increase material expenses significantly.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ows generally fall between $500 and $1,500. The price depends on the complexity of the installation and local labor rates, with some projects costing around $1,000 on average.

Permitting and Inspection - Permit fees and inspection costs can add approximately $50 to $200 to the overall project budget. These costs vary based on local regulations and whether inspections are required during installation.

Total Project Costs - Overall, the total cost for escape window installation services often ranges from $750 to $2,500. Factors influencing the total include window size, material choices, and site-specific conditions in Bath, ME and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
